Okay so I have made it through replacing the Speedo Cable, getting a newer dash cluster in, new slave cylinder, new rear cylinders, etc.

This weekend I was readjusting the brakes per some info from the list and there are doing great. But while I was under the engine I noticed two small puddles of coolant. Both were located just below the point where the pushrod tubes contact the engine. If the heads were leaking this would seem like the obvious place the coolant would drip from. The pushrod tube cover plates are in tact. I have been thinking of pulling the heads anyway to fix the leaky pushrod tube seals(Oil Leaky). But is it normal for the heads to both leak at the same time? Ilooked all over the engine from above and what I could see from below. I can't seem to find where the coolant is coming from.

Any suggestions? I really would like to put off pulling the heads and such for a while. Currently I am not over heating and the oil usage is minimal as well as loss of coolant.
